It could be called a miracle in the modern history that the emergence of Israel in 1948. It was the outcome of three factors: the struggle of a group of Zionist, the support of great countries and the changing world situation in early 20th century. The special history of Jews and the extraordinary road of its country-building have a huge impact on Israel nation-building. This thesis explores the formation of Israeli nation and the formation of its citizens' attachment to the nation. Under this theme, I choose four pairs of contradictions that beset oday's Israeli society: the controversy of Ideology, the contradictions of national morority Jews and the national minority Arabs, the idea of modeling a single national culture and the reality of pluralistic culture, the conflict of religion and secularism. These topics compose the main body of the thesis.The fact is that, with the development of Israel's economy, the improvement of it's state power and the political system, the state-building of Israel is going to be finished, and achieved noticeable success. While on the other hand, Israel's nation-building is slow, lags far behind its state-building. Ideology, ethnic group and religion mingles with each other, brings many paradox and divergence. This thesis is guided by Marx's materialist conception of history. Through analysis and study, I have reached following conculsion:1,Zionsim is composed of Labor Zionism, Revisism Zionism and Religion Zionism. Under the common aim of building Israel and maintain its development, these three schools collaborate while struggle, and become the main force of Israel nation-building.2,Zionism is the dominant ideology of Israel's political and social life, but the hegemony status of it has been weakened. It has o face the challenge of Neo-Zionism from the redical right camp and Post-Zionsim from the democratic left camp.3,Melting-pot policy is necessary for creat a united national identity and civic culture. Israel's melting-pot policy is directed by the Western and modern culture of Ashkenazi, the outcome is the emergence of ethnic stratification and ethnic identity.4,On the basis of ethnic identity, orential Jews and former Soviet immigrants, as well as Arabs, all build ethnic political parties. The politicizing of ethnic group is the important feature of Israel's political life.5,Under the Zionism ideology , Israel's nation-building is equaled with Jewish re-construction and revival. Arabs are excluded Israel's nation-building as outsiders, and become the "internal colonized" national minority.6,Judaism's great impact on society and religion party's excessive political power make Israel wavered between secular democracy and theocracy. The divergence and conflict of them has led Israel's gravest national identiy crisis, which limits the normal and healthy development of Israeli domestic affairs and foreign affairs.7,In the process of Israel's nation-building, ideology, ethnic group and religion coordinate and condition with each other, there is an interactive relationship among these three factors.
